How HGH Works
HGH stimulates tissue growth and regeneration by promoting collagen synthesis, increasing the uptake of amino acids into cells, and encouraging fat metabolism. This leads to:
- Increased muscle mass
- Enhanced recovery from injuries
- Reduced body fat
How Steroids Work
Anabolic steroids are synthetic derivatives of testosterone that promote muscle building, enhance strength, and improve physical endurance. Their key effects include:
- Increased protein synthesis
- Increased nitrogen retention
- Enhanced red blood cell production

Risks and Considerations
While the combination of HGH and steroids can offer significant benefits, it is essential to be aware of the potential side effects associated with their use, which can include:
- Increased risk of cardiovascular issues
- Hormonal imbalances
- Joint and muscle pain
Post-cycle therapy (PCT) is often recommended to help restore natural hormone levels after a cycle involving these substances. It’s crucial for anyone considering this combination to consult with a healthcare professional to mitigate risks and ensure responsible usage.
